A 78-year-old Saskatoon man has been charged following a historical sexual assault investigation.
Saskatoon police said Tuesday they were contacted by Calgary police earlier this year, when a 50-year-old woman reported being sexually assaulted as a student, four decades ago.
Police said the suspect resides in Saskatoon and taught the victim between 1977 and 1979, when the incidents are alleged to have taken place.
The now 78-year-old suspect was arrested by members of the sex crimes and child abuse unit Friday. He’s charged with indecent assault.
